Ottawa police threaten to arrest any protesters blocking streets

Ottawa police threatened on Wednesday to arrest any protesters blocking the streets, for the first time following 13 days of protests once morest health measures paralyzing the Canadian capital.

“We are warning you that anyone blocking the streets or helping others to block them may be prosecuted” and “is likely to be arrested,” police warned in a statement, adding that vehicles might also be seized.
